Nineteen-year-old Ginni Mahi is a Punjabi folk, pop and hip-hop musician who uses her music to challenge the caste system. Ginni grew up in a Dalit community, considered the lowest caste in India. Since rocketing to social media stardom in 2016, Ginni has been dubbed “a viral voice of assertion for ‘lower’ castes”. WorldLink talked to her.
